ABSTRACT
Objective To determine whether 3'UTR polymorphisms of the NRAMP1 gene are as-sociated with tuberculosis in Uighurs. Methods 3'UTR polymorphisms of NRAMP1 gene were typed by PCR-RFLP among 224 patients with active tuberculosis and 225 healthy individuals. The relationship be-tween 3'UTR polymorphisms and susceptibility to tuberculosis was studied, and cases were grouped accord-ing to genotypes. Results In the tuberculosis patients, genotype TGTG/TGTG,TGTG/TGTG deleted, and TGTG deleted/TGTG deleted were observed in 159,56 and 9 cases respectively, while the genotypes of the healthy controls were TGTG/TGTG in 185, TGTG/TGTG deleted in 36 and TGTG deleted/TGTG deleted in 4 case. The frequency of the genotype TGTG/TGTG was found more often among controls than that in pa-tients (X2=7.94 ,P <0.01). The frequency of allele TGTG and the frequency of variant allele were 0.87 and 0.13 respectively. Conclusion 3'UTR polymorphisms of NRAMP1 gene are associated with suscepti-bility to tuberculosis in Uighurs.
